This workshop experiments with the cyanotype technique, created by John Herschel in 1842, explored by Anna Atkins, photographer and botanist, and by artists such as R. Rauschenber and Susan Weil. The combination of diverse elements taken from our daily use, such as cuttings, plants, shells, glass and the body itself, contribute to the creation of new images and new narrative spaces, in various shades of blue.

Escola EB1 Augusto Lessa – World Children’s Day Party!
APEAL – Associação de Pais EB1 Augusto Lessa, invited Casa da Imagem to spend the 3rd of June 2013 with the boys and girls of this school holding a cyanotype workshop. The trees of this school were the starting point and their inhabitants were created throughout the day.
